websettings |
Настройки WEB интерфейса. |
timerange |
Временные диапазоны. |
sconfig |
Сопоставление списков URL с шаблонами. |
redirect |
Списки URL. |
sconfig_time |
Сопоставление временных диапазонов с шаблонами. |
proxy |
Настройки прокси сервера. |
passwd |
Пользователи - администраторы. В таблице содержится логин и пароль пользователя-администратора SAMS. В SAMS2 права на администрирование SAMS можно задать для любого пользователя.
|
shablon |
Шаблоны пользователей. |
samslog |
Протокол событий SAMS2. |
sgroup |
Группы пользователей. |
reconfig |
Команды демону из WEB интерфейса. |
url |
Содержание группы URL адресов. |
squiduser |
Пользователи. |
squidcache |
Подробная информация о трафике пользователей. |
cachesum |
Суммарная информация о трафике пользователей за однодневный период. |
auth_param |
Параметры различных способов авторизации. |
Имя поля |
Тип поля |
Параметры |
Значение по умолчанию |
Описание |
s_proxy_id |
|
SERIAL PRIMARY KEY |
|
Первичный ключ таблицы. |
s_description |
varchar(100) |
|
Proxy server |
Описание прокси сервера. |
s_endvalue |
bigint |
NOT NULL |
0 |
Смещение в файле access.log, с которого начинается обработка. |
s_redirect_to |
varchar(100) |
|
http://your.ip.addr.. |
Путь к файлу перенаправления запроса. |
s_denied_to |
varchar(100) |
|
http://your.ip.addr.. |
Путь к каталогу где лежат файлы запрета запроса. |
s_redirector |
varchar(25) |
|
NONE |
Какой используется редиректор. Возможные значения:
none – не использовать редиректор
sams – встроенный редиректор
rejik – внешний редиректор rejik
squidquard – внешний редиректор squidguard
|
s_delaypool |
smallint |
|
0 |
Устарело и более не используется.
Использовать или нет ограничение скорости канала
(shablon.s_shablonpool и shablon.s_userpool).
|
s_auth |
varchar(4) |
|
ip |
Тип авторизации в системе по умолчанию.
Непонятно когда используется. По умолчанию значит если где-то не указано, а где может быть не указано?
|
s_wbinfopath |
varchar(100) |
|
/usr/bin |
Путь к wbinfo. |
s_separator |
varchar(15) |
|
+ |
Разделитель домена и имени пользователя. Обычно + или \ или @ |
s_usedomain |
smallint |
|
0 |
Использовать или нет домен при создании acl файлов. |
s_bigd |
smallint |
|
0 |
Как записывать домен при создании acl файлов.
0 – DOMAIN
1 – domain
2 – Domain
|
s_bigu |
smallint |
|
0 |
Как записывать пользователя при создании acl файлов.
0 – USER
1 – user
2 – User
|
s_sleep |
smallint |
|
1 |
Время (секунды) через которое samsdaemon опрашивает БД насчет команд. |
s_parser |
smallint |
|
0 |
Выбор обработчика значений.
0 – не обрабатывать логи
1 – раз в промежуток времени
2 – постоянный (устарел и не используется)
|
s_parser_time |
smallint |
|
1 |
Промежуток времени (минуты) через которое запускается обработчик логов. Используется если s_parser=1 |
s_count_clean |
smallint |
|
0 |
Очищать или нет счетчики пользователей при окончании периода лимита в шаблонах. |
s_nameencode |
smallint |
|
0 |
Перекодировать или нет имена пользователей при их записи в ACL. |
s_realsize |
varchar(4) |
|
real |
Тип учитываемого трафика.
real – реально полученный пользователем
full – весь трафик, включая и кэш
|
s_checkdns |
smallint |
|
0 |
Преобразовывать или нет имена в IP адреса при обработке логов. |
s_debuglevel |
smallint |
|
0 |
Уровень отладки. Возможные значения:
1 –
2 –
3 –
4 –
5 –
6 –
7 –
8 –
9 – Показывать работу вспомогательных функций
|
s_defaultdomain |
char(25) |
|
WORKGROUP |
Домен по умолчанию. |
s_squidbase |
smallint |
|
0 |
Количество месяцев, за которые сохранять данные о трафике в базе. |
s_udscript |
varchar(100) |
|
NONE |
Скрипт, выполняемый при отключении пользователя. |
s_adminaddr |
varchar(60) |
|
root@localhost |
Адрес администратора. |
s_kbsize |
varchar(15) |
NOT NULL |
1024 |
Размер килобайта в байтах. |
s_mbsize |
varchar(15) |
NOT NULL |
1048576 |
Размер мегабайта в байтах. |
s_ldapserver |
varchar(30) |
|
0.0.0.0 |
Имя или адрес LDAP сервера. |
s_ldapbasedn |
varchar(50) |
|
workgroup |
Домен. |
s_ldapuser |
varchar(50) |
|
Administrator |
Пользователь - администратор домена. |
s_ldappasswd |
varchar(50) |
|
0 |
Пароль администратора. |
s_ldapusergroup |
varchar(50) |
|
Users |
Группа. |
Имя поля |
Тип поля |
Параметры |
Значение по умолчанию |
Описание |
s_shablon_id |
|
SERIAL PRIMARY KEY |
|
Первичный ключ таблицы. |
s_name |
varchar(25) |
|
NULL |
Имя шаблона. |
s_shablonpool |
bigint |
|
0 |
Ограничение скорости всего шаблона. |
s_userpool |
bigint |
|
0 |
Ограничение скорости пользователя шаблона. |
s_auth |
varchar(4) |
|
ip |
Тип авторизации пользователей шаблона. Возможные значения:
ip – по IP адресу
ncsa – по имени/паролю
ntlm – в домене Windows
adld – в ActiveDirectory
ldap – в OpenLDAP
|
s_quote |
int |
|
100 |
Ограничение трафика пользователя шаблона. В мегабайтах. |
s_period |
varchar(3) |
|
M |
Период ограничения трафика. Возможные значения:
M – месяц
W – неделя
D - день
число – количество дней
|
s_clrdate |
date |
|
1980-01-01 |
Дата следующей очистки счетчиков трафика. Используется только при нестандартном периоде ограничения. |
s_alldenied |
smallint |
|
0 |
Признак что доступ запрещен везде. Используется для разрешения доступа только к ресурсам из списка allow. |
s_shablon_id2 |
int |
|
NULL |
Идентификатор вторичного шаблона. Если не NULL и не -1, то вместо блокировки, пользователи переводятся во вторичный шаблон до
тех пор, пока не произойдет очистка счетчиков у вторичного шаблона или пока пользователь не превысит лимит вторичного шаблона.
|
Имя поля |
Тип поля |
Параметры |
Значение по умолчанию |
Описание |
s_user_id |
|
SERIAL PRIMARY KEY |
|
Первичный ключ таблицы. |
s_group_id |
int |
|
|
Идентификатор группы из таблицы group. |
s_shablon_id |
int |
|
|
Идентификатор шаблона из таблицы shablon. |
s_nick |
char(50) |
|
NULL |
Логин. |
s_family |
char(50) |
|
NULL |
Фамилия. |
s_name |
char(50) |
|
NULL |
Имя. |
s_soname |
char(50) |
|
NULL |
Отчество. |
s_domain |
char(50) |
|
NULL |
Домен. |
s_quote |
int |
NOT NULL |
0 |
Ограничение трафика в мегабайтах. При значении -1 используется значение shablon.s_quote. |
s_size |
bigint |
NOT NULL |
0 |
Общий объем использованного трафика в байтах. |
s_hit |
bigint |
NOT NULL |
0 |
Объем трафика из кэша в байтах. |
s_enabled |
smallint |
|
1 |
Статус активности.
-1 – отключен администратором.
0 – отключен за превышение трафика.
1 – активный.
2 – переведен в другой шаблон за превышение трафика.
|
s_ip |
char(15) |
|
|
IP адрес пользователя. Используется вместо s_nick если shablon.s_auth=ip. |
s_passwd |
varchar(20) |
|
|
Пароль на доступ (хэш). Используется если shablon.s_auth=ncsa. |
s_gauditor |
smallint |
|
0 |
Устарело и более не используется. Может или нет смотреть трафик своей группы. |
s_autherrorc |
smallint |
|
0 |
Счетчик неверных авторизаций. После 3х неверно введенных паролей счетчик обнуляется и доступ в веб интерфейсе блокируется
на 1 минуту. При верно введенном пароле обнуляется.
|
s_autherrort |
varchar(16) |
|
0 |
Время когда пользователь сможет войти в веб интерфейс. Имеет смысл если s_autherrorc > 0. |
s_webaccess |
varchar(16) |
|
W |
Права доступа в веб интерфейсе. Набор символов, каждый из которых отвечает за свой уровень доступа.
W – Имеет право смотреть свою статистику.
G – Имеет право смотреть статистику пользователей своей группы
S – Имеет право смотреть статистику Всех пользователей
A – Имеет право активировать/отключать пользователей
U – Имеет право добавлять пользователей в SAMS
L – Имеет право изменять списки URL
C – Имеет право настраивать SAMS
|